semiconductorLi₁Tm₁Tl₂ is an experimental ternary intermetallic compound combining lithium, thulium (a rare-earth element), and thallium. This material belongs to the family of rare-earth-containing intermetallics, which are primarily investigated in academic and research settings for their potential electronic and magnetic properties rather than established industrial production. While not yet commercialized, compounds in this chemical family are of interest for understanding phase behavior in multi-component systems and for exploring potential applications in advanced semiconducting or thermoelectric devices, though alternative rare-earth compounds with more established processing routes are typically preferred in practical engineering contexts.
